Petition of Albert G. Lane, Register of Probate of Washington County, praying for increase of Salary, came up referred to a Joint Select Committee, consisting on the part of the House of the Delegation of Washington County, with such as the Senate may join. Read and referred and Messrs. J. Reman and J.R. Redman are joined in concurrence.

Petition of Lucy Atwood, praying to be divorced from her husband Stevens Atwood Jr. Petition of Jesse Hutchings, praying to have the marriage convent between him and his wife annulled, severalty read and referred to the Committee on the Judiciary in concurrence.

Petition of Eleazer Packard and others praying for an Academy at Houlton - read and referred to the Committee on Literature and Literary Institutions in concurrence

Petition of the Directors of Union Bank in Brunswick, praying for an increase of Capital - read and referred to the committee on Banks and Banking, in concurrence.

Petition of Alason Carey and others, praying to be annexed to Harrison - read and referred to the Committee on Division of Towns in concurrence.

Description: The journal of the Senate documents the proceedings in the chamber, including actions taken on bills, petitions and reports from committees read, and votes taken. The journals are not transcripts and therefore do not include floor speeches that are found in the modern Legislative Records.
